George Bouchek
MilitaryOriginal photos from the family of George Bouchek (Darlene Bouchek Fitzgerald)
Shot down 12 May 1944 in B-17 #42-31345 'Lady Stardust II'. Plane ditched in Channel. Returned to base.
Passed away on 3/17/2007 in Garden City Michigan at the age of 86. Surviving family include his daughter (and son-in-law) Darlene & John Fitzgerald and three grand children, Rachael, Ryan and Olivia Fitzgerald.
